Descriere



A small lightweight mod to allow editing of civilian ships and stations. Includes Improved Transport Ship Behaviors and Transport Upgrades!


  • New ships for colonziers, construction, science vessels
  • More custom components
  • Maybe some new civilian stations that increase output


    • Savegame Compatible
    • Not Ironman Compatible
    • I made changes to multiple vanilla game files so it may be incompatible with other mods that alter ships or ship components. Let me know! I will make compat's if needed. Be aware that the AI will use this also in your game.

Now, onto the main point:

It all comes down to load order.

If this mod is placed below Starbase Extended, it will overwrite any shared files between the two.

If it's placed above SE3.0, then SE3.0 will take priority and overwrite the shared elements.

This mod modifies vanilla starbases (from Outpost to Citadel) to increase values like platform limits, building capacity, and module slots. It also extends these tweaks to NSC starbases with the same goals in mind.
